HTML JPG PDF XML DOCX
  Product Family
PDF

Convertir EPUB en PDF dans Go SDK

Exportez des documents EPUB vers plusieurs formats, y compris PDF avec Aspose.PDF Cloud Go SDK

Get Started

Comment convertir EPUB en PDF en utilisant Go SDK

Pour convertir EPUB en PDF, nous utiliserons Aspose.PDF Cloud Go SDK Ce SDK Cloud assiste les programmeurs Go dans le développement d’applications créatrices, annotatrices, éditrices et convertisseuses de PDF basées sur le cloud en utilisant le langage de programmation Go via Aspose.PDF REST API. Utilisez la commande suivante depuis la console du gestionnaire de packages.

Commande de la console du gestionnaire de packages


     
    go get -u github.com/aspose-pdf-cloud/aspose-pdf-cloud-go/v25
     
     

Étapes pour convertir EPUB en PDF via Go

Les développeurs Aspose.PDF Cloud Go peuvent facilement charger et convertir des fichiers EPUB en PDF en quelques lignes de code.

  1. Téléchargement d’un fichier EPUB sur le stockage Cloud Aspose.
  2. Conversion de l’EPUB en PDF.
  3. Enregistrement du PDF de sortie dans le stockage cloud.
 

Ce code exemple montre la conversion EPUB en PDF Cloud Go SDK


    package main

    import (
        "fmt"
        "path"

        asposepdfcloud "github.com/aspose-pdf-cloud/aspose-pdf-cloud-go/v25"
    )

    func convertEpubToPdf(pdf_api *asposepdfcloud.PdfApiService, epub_document string, pdf_name string, remote_folder string) {
        args := map[string]interface{}{
            "folder": remote_folder,
        }

        src_path := path.Join(remote_folder, epub_document)

        result, httpResponse, err := pdf_api.PutEpubInStorageToPdf(pdf_name, src_path, args)

        if err != nil {
            fmt.Println(err.Error())
        } else if httpResponse.StatusCode < 200 || httpResponse.StatusCode > 299 {
            fmt.Println("Unexpected error!")
        } else {
            fmt.Println(result)
        }
    }
 
  • Autres conversions prises en charge

    Vous pouvez également convertir de nombreux autres formats de fichiers, dont quelques-uns listés ci-dessous.

    BMP EN PDF (Image Bitmap)
    CGM EN PDF (Format Binaire Microsoft Word)
    EMF EN PDF (Document Words Office 2007+)
    EPUB EN PDF (Format de Métafile Amélioré)
    GIF EN PDF (Format d'Échange Graphique)
    HTML EN PDF (Langage de Balises HyperText)
    JPEG EN PDF (Groupe d'Experts en Photographie)
    LATEX EN PDF (Texte de Sortie LaTeX)
    PCL EN PDF (Langage de Commande d'Imprimante)
    MD EN PDF (Markdown)
    PDF EN BMP (Image Bitmap)
    PDF EN EPUB (Format de Livre Électronique)
    PDF EN GIF (Format d'Échange Graphique)
    PDF EN HTML (Langage de Balises HyperText)
    PDF EN JPEG (Groupe d'Experts en Photographie)
    PDF EN PDF/A (Format de Document Portable)
    PDF EN PNG (Graphiques en Réseau Portable)
    PDF EN PPTX (Microsoft PowerPoint)
    PDF EN SVG (Graphiques Vectoriels Adaptatifs)
    PDF À TEX (Système de graphismes informatiques)
    PDF À TIFF (Format d'image balisé)
    PDF À WORD (Format binaire Microsoft Word)
    PDF À XLSX (Fichier de feuille de calcul Microsoft Excel Open XML Format)
    PDF À XPS (Spécifications du papier XML)
    PNG À PDF (Graphiques réseau portables)
    PS À PDF (PostScript)
    SVG À PDF (Graphiques vectoriels adaptatifs)
    TEXTE À PDF (Document texte)
    TIFF À PDF (Format d'image balisé)
    XPS À PDF (Spécifications du papier XML)